Understanding the Importance of a Weatherproof Design

One of the primary concerns customers have is whether the vehicles can withstand different weather conditions. In areas with frequent rain, snow, or extreme heat, customers worry about how their cleaning vehicles will perform and last over time. A weatherproof design ensures that these vehicles can operate effectively in varying climates without suffering damage.

Solution: Look for IP Ratings

When researching WPCVs, pay close attention to their Ingress Protection (IP) ratings. An IP rating consists of two numbers; the first indicates protection against solid objects and dust, while the second rates protection against water. For instance, a rating of IP65 means the vehicle is dust tight and can withstand low-pressure water jets from any direction.

Many leading manufacturers now offer WPCVs with IP ratings of IP66 or higher, making them suitable for extreme weather. For example, a case study from SolarClean Inc. showed that their IP66-rated vehicle consistently performed under harsh conditions, reducing downtime by 30% compared to lower-rated models.

Ease of Use and Maintenance

Another issue faced by buyers is the complexity of operating and maintaining WPCVs. Customers often fear that complicated machinery will lead to high operational costs and frequent repairs, impacting their overall return on investment.

Solution: Trainability and Support

When selecting a cleaning vehicle, inquire about training programs and customer support provided by the manufacturer. Opt for companies that offer comprehensive training for staff, ensuring that users can easily operate and maintain the vehicles. A reputable company will provide instructional materials and even on-site training sessions.

For instance, Bright Clean Technologies has implemented a customer success program that results in a 95% satisfaction rate among their users. According to client feedback, vehicles that came with training support reduced maintenance costs by an average of 15% annually, ultimately benefiting customers’ bottom lines.
